Output 7035435d64996c3063830b724436eafe694ece2dd9ff86bfe399376a33da6882:21

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 225ca96eb49ae641a2d20be4d06c9b58d1a52b568f18e4c097e9ffe6efa421f2
address
bc1pyfw2jm45ntnyrgkjp0jdqmymtrg6226k3uvwfsyha8l7dmayy8eq4jee0c
transaction
7035435d64996c3063830b724436eafe694ece2dd9ff86bfe399376a33da6882
spent
true